Lemon Drizzle Cake
Loving my HO, I cant stop cooking!
I only cook for one so only a small recipe.
This recipe I have used many times in conv oven. Works well in the HO, if not better.
1 egg Juice of 1 lemon
60g sugar 3 teasp sugar
60g butter
60g self raising flour
grated rind of 1 lemon
Cream butter and sugar together, add beaten egg and lemon rind.
Stir in flour.
Put into lined, small loaf tin.
Bake on bottom rack of HO on 150 for 25 - 30 mins.
Once cooked, prick all over with a skewer, stir 3 teaspoons sugar into the lemon juice and pour all over the cake. Once cooled the excess sugar will crystalise.
Hope you like it.
